Uses, Side Effects, Price of Lagrima-H Gel

Lagrima-H Gel is an eye lubricant or artificial tears used to relieve dry eyes. This can happen because not enough tears are made to keep the eye lubricated. It helps to soothe the irritation and burning seen in dry eyes by maintaining proper lubrication of the eyes.

Lagrima-H Gel is usually taken when needed. Use the number of drops as advised by your doctor. Wait for at least 5-10 minutes before delivering any other medication in the same eye to avoid dilution. Do not use a bottle if the seal is broken before you open it. Always wash your hands and do not touch the end of the dropper. This could infect your eye. This medicine may require long-term use and can be taken safely for as long as you need it.

The most common side effects of using this medicine are blurred or altered vision, and sometimes pain in the eye. Let your doctor know if you experience these symptoms but they are usually temporary. Do not drive, use machinery, or do any activity that requires clear vision until you are sure you can do it safely. Consult your doctor if your condition does not improve or if the side effects bother you.

This medicine is not likely to affect or be affected by other medicines you use but tell your doctor if you have ever had glaucoma. Do not use it while wearing soft contact lenses and talk to your doctor if you develop an eye infection while using it.

Benefits of Lagrima-H Gel

In Dry eyes

Normally your eyes produce enough natural tears to help them move easily and comfortably and to remove dust and other particles. If they do not produce enough tears, they can become dry, red and painful. Dry eyes can be caused by wind, sun, heating, computer use, and some medications. Lagrima-H Gel keeps your eyes lubricated and can relieve any dryness and pain. They will also help protect your eyes from injury and infection.

SIDE EFFECTS OF Lagrima-H Gel

Most side effects do not require any medical attention and disappear as your body adjusts to the medicine. Consult your doctor if they persist or if you’re worried about them

  • Blurred vision
  • Eye irritation
  • Eye pain
  • Eye redness
  • Foreign body sensation in eyes

FAQs:

Q1. What is Lagrima-H Gel? Lagrima-H Gel belongs to a class of medicines called eye lubricants or artificial tears. It is available as eye drops. It is used to soothe irritation, burning and discomfort of dry eye conditions. One may experience such conditions because of deficient tear production, infrequent blinking, smoke, wind, pollution, extended use of computer screen or television, medical treatment or dry atmospheric conditions. Lagrima-H Gel may also be used to aid insertion of lenses or to make the lenses more comfortable while wearing.

Q2. Is Lagrima-H Gel effective? Lagrima-H Gel is effective if used in the dose and duration advised by your doctor. Do not stop taking it even if you see improvement in your condition. If you stop using Lagrima-H Gel too early, the symptoms may return or worsen.

Q3. In which conditions is the use of Lagrima-H Gel avoided? Use of Lagrima-H Gel should be avoided in patients who are allergic to Lagrima-H Gel or any of its components. However, if you are not aware of any allergy or if you are using Lagrima-H Gel for the first time, consult your doctor.
